Unlocking ECU for variant coding?

Experts, has anyone seen DAS error 8.561.6067 when trying to reprogram ECU (ME17) using Adaptation -> Variant Coding option?
Google says the ECU needs to be unlocked first - how to unlock it on W221? Others say that the coding values need to be in a plausible combination - does it make sense? Thanks!

You can do this with Vediamo configured with a Seed Key or high acesss level, under Functions for the ECU look for DJ_Zugriffsberechtigung.
